Ice Storm Warning Thawed

The National Weather Service has downgraded the Ice Storm Warning currently in effect for Northeast Georgia to a Winter Storm warning as of 2:47am.  The warning will still expire at 1:00pm tomorrow

Projections are calling for an 80% chance of snow tonight, with a low around 26 degrees.  On Thursday, the chance of snow is projected to taper off after noon, with a 60% chance of precipitation tomorrow morning.  The high will be near 41 degrees and partly sunny skies in the afternoon.
